The Book Vine for Children is a distributor of quality children’s books in McHenry, Illinois.
 
We are looking for an experienced Operations Coordinator who will be the liaison with clients and will provide excellent customer service while building customer relationships.


Responsibilities include:

  • Directs, coordinates and completes fulfillment projects
  • Assigns and schedules warehouse employees on a day to day basis, following up on work results
  • Enhances warehouse operations systems by determining product handling and storage requirements. Develops, implements, enforces, and evaluates policies and procedures, along with inventory management and shipping.
  • Contributes to creating and recommending strategic plans and reviews, in order to achieve operational objectives
  • Plans and schedules timelines
  • Communicates project progress, problems and solutions
  • Reviews orders and invoices on a daily basis

Skills include:

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Critical thinking an problem-solving skills
  • Detail-oriented
  • Deadline-oriented
  • Team Player
  • Responsible/Takes Ownership
  • Open/ Accepts Constructive Criticism
  • Good relationship with management
  • Ability to manage team members effectively
  • Self-management: successfully manages self, seeks other’s input, tracks and reports status, communicates issues against agreed plans prior to problems arising. Flexible and adaptable, behaves in a way that embraces change.
  • Initiative and enterprise: produces quantity of work that is consistent with role. Responds to unscheduled requests on a timely basis. Asks for more work when available. Takes responsibility for own work. Takes pride in self and success of business.

Qualifications:

  • Data entry management
  • Knowledge of project management techniques and tools
  •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office
  • Bachelor’s Degree preferred
